LyrArc Article Gist
A touching story about a soldier who was once part of the Lost Battalion in World War II in the Vosges French Alps. Ford Callis is determined to recover at Vanderbilt Medical Center in Nashville from a fall at home. His only thought is how he can get back to care for his demented 94 year old wife. A physician who takes care of Callis describes the thoughts of doctors and staff at Vanderbilt Medical Center that day as they reflected on the meaning of marraige in a deeper spiritual sense.
